ConductAtlas Analysis

Why it matters (compliance & governance perspective)

Users are required to pursue unresolved disputes through JAMS arbitration rather than through court litigation, limiting the forums available to them.

Consumer impact (what this means for users)

If your dispute with Impact is not resolved through verbal and written communications, you must submit it to JAMS arbitration rather than pursue it in court.
